EI_ScriptName – Definiowanie nazw/ ID/ innych opcji sterujących dla poszczególnych skryptów`

Arkusz EI_ScriptName zawiera tylko nazwy skryptów, odpowiadający im identyfikator i typ oraz opcjonalne informacje o trybie wykonania skryptu, makrach użytkownika. Zazwyczaj wypełnia się tylko kolumny A, B i C. W arkuszu może być jeden lub więcej skryptów. Ich nazwy/identyfikatory/typy  powinny być umieszczione od wiersza 7 począwszy, w kolejnych wierszach.

 

Kolumna

Pole

Znaczenie pola

A

Opis skryptu

Opis skryptu wybierany przez użytkownika na wstążce EasyInput

B

ID Skryptu

Krótki techniczny Identyfikator skryptu, Identyfikator skryptu nie powinien zawierać znaków innych niż cyfry i litery (np. spacji)

C

Typ skryptu

Następujące typy skryptów zostały dotychczas zdefnionowane:

GS – Skrypt SAP GUI, TR-Skrypt transakcyjny, FM – Skrypt funkcyjny, OD - Skrypt OData

Zobacz sekcję informacje o produkcie,by dowiedzieć się więcej o typach skryptów.

D

Tryb wykonania (opcja)

Pole opcjonalne (wykorzystywane tylko dla skryptów transakcyjnych TR). Jeśli puste Tryb wykonania ustalany jest na podstawie domyślnej wartości z arkusza konfiguracji. Wpis w tym miejscu pozwala wybrać różne sposoby wykonania dla różnych skryptów transakcyjnych.

Pusty = > wartość domyślna z arkusza konfiguracji

B-Standard = Batch Input

C-Rozszerzony = No batch Input, Read capability

D-Rozszerzony = Batch Input, stary CATT, nie zalecany

E

Makro VBA wywoływane przed skryptem (opcja)

Pole opcjonalne wykorzystywane jeśli użytkownik chce rozszerzyć funkcjonalność EasyInput za pomocą własnych makr VBA. Patrz rozdział Tips & Tricks.

F

Makro VBA wywoływane po skrypcie (opcja)

Pole opcjonalne wykorzystywane jeśli użytkownik chce rozszerzyć funkcjonalność EasyInput za pomocą własnych makr VBA. Patrz rozdział Tips & Tricks.

G

Arkusz z danymi (opcja)

Pole opcjonalne. Jeśli puste Arkusz danych ustalany jest na podstawie domyślnej wartości z arkusza konfiguracji.

H

Odczytywanie wartości komunikatu (opcja)

Pole opcjonalne. Jeśli puste Ciąg odczytywania wartości komunikatu ustalany jest na podstawie domyślnej wartości z arkusza konfiguracji.

I

Arkusz rezultatów (opcja)

Pole opcjonalne. Jeśli puste, Arkuszem Rezultatów, w którym zwracane są rezultaty (ReadData) jest Arkusz Danych. Jeśli podano ID innego arkusza to właśnie w tym arkuszu zwrócone zostaną dane odczytane przez skrypt.

Arkusz Rezultatów inny niż Arkusz Danych wykorzystywany jest przede wszystkim przy raportowaniu. Np., gdy użytkownik chce, by kryteria raportowania pozostały na Arkuszu Danych, a wyniki raportowania zostały umieszczone na Arkuszu Rezultatów.

J

Pierwsza linia arkusza rezultatów (opcja)

Pole opcjonalne. Pozwala określić inny niż domyślny pierwszy wiersz danych zapisywanych do Arkusza Rezultatów. Ma znaczenie tylko jeśli Arkusz Rezultatów jest podany. Standardowo dane są zwracane na Arkusz Rezultatów począwszy od wiersza 2 (wiersz pierwszy zarezerwowany na opisy). Podając wartość (>=1) można wymusić wklejanie danych rezultatu począwszy od wybranego wiersza.